Understanding the Cash App Borrow Feature
The Cash App Borrow feature allows users to access short-term loans directly through the Cash App. It’s a convenient way to get quick cash when you need it, without having to go through a traditional bank or credit union. However, it’s important to note that the Cash App Borrow feature is not available to all users, as it depends on your creditworthiness and the terms set by Square, Inc., the company behind Cash App.
Reasons for the Cash App Borrow Not Working Today
There are several reasons why the Cash App Borrow feature might not be working today. Here are some of the most common ones:
-
System Maintenance: Square, Inc. may be performing routine maintenance on their servers, which can temporarily disrupt the Cash App Borrow feature.
-
Network Issues: Poor internet connectivity or network outages can prevent the Cash App Borrow feature from functioning properly.
-
Technical Glitches: Sometimes, technical glitches within the Cash App itself can cause the Borrow feature to malfunction.
-
Account Restrictions: If you have violated any terms of service or have a poor credit history, your Cash App Borrow feature may be restricted or disabled.

What You Can Do to Resolve the Issue
Here are some steps you can take to resolve the Cash App Borrow not working today issue:
-
Check Your Internet Connection: Ensure that you have a stable internet connection. Sometimes, a weak signal can cause the Cash App Borrow feature to malfunction.
-
Update the Cash App: Make sure that you have the latest version of the Cash App installed on your device. Older versions may have compatibility issues.
-
Restart Your Device: Sometimes, simply restarting your device can resolve technical glitches.
-
Contact Cash App Support: If none of the above steps work, reach out to Cash App support for assistance. They can provide you with more information about the issue and guide you on how to resolve it.
